City Still Interested In Fulop

Last updated : 19 June 2006 By Covsupport
Coventry City are still trying to sign Marton Fulop from Tottenham Hotspur. A bid of £1.5m over five years had been rejected by Spurs but with Fulop highly keen to play once more for the Sky Blues where he was part of last season's success,City have renewed their interest.

Said Paul Fletcher speaking to the CET: "We are trying everything in our power to get Marton Fulop at a price that the club can afford.

"Fulop has been linked with Wigan but they seem to be making a move for Chris Kirkland which perhaps helps our cause a bit.

"But the thing we have in our favour is the fact that Marton wants to come here. Unfortunately,we appear to be caught in a bit of a waiting game."
